The Jacksonville real estate market has clearly shifted into a strategy-driven environment. Inventory levels, buyer behavior, and pricing sensitivity across Duval, Clay, St. Johns, and Nassau counties all point to the same conclusion: success today depends on data, preparation, and professional execution—not guesswork.

For Jacksonville sellers, pricing accuracy is critical. Homes that enter the market aligned with recent neighborhood sales and current buyer demand continue to move. Properties priced based on past highs or emotion are sitting longer, accumulating days on market, and ultimately requiring reductions. In this market, condition, presentation, and timing directly affect net proceeds. Sellers who prepare correctly before going live maintain leverage; those who do not often lose it.

For Jacksonville buyers, opportunity exists—but only with discipline. Buyers who are properly pre-approved, understand local pricing trends, and submit clean, well-structured offers are winning. VA, FHA, and conventional financing remain strong options in Northeast Florida when presented correctly, especially in competitive submarkets near employment centers, military bases, and major infrastructure corridors.

Jacksonville is not a single market—it is a collection of micro-markets. What works in the Northside may not work in Mandarin, Riverside, Fleming Island, or Nocatee. Understanding these differences is where experienced representation becomes essential.
